Output 51a318397d5894de63123b431e9a81003db44ff488dacd61a97b30b988549edf:1

value
58721608
script pubkey
OP_0 OP_PUSHBYTES_20 e6c407e6140f06c8e461620a117ce608c239dd02
address
bc1qumzq0es5purv3erpvg9pzl8xprprnhgz2chyvn
transaction
51a318397d5894de63123b431e9a81003db44ff488dacd61a97b30b988549edf
confirmations
124957
spent
true